sock = socket.socket(socket.AF_INET6, socket.SOCK_DGRAM)
# Disable IPV6_V6ONLY option to enable dual-stack (listen on IPv4 as well)
# This option is system-dependent; on many systems, setting it to False enables
# the socket to handle both IPv4 and IPv6 traffic.
try:
sock.setsockopt(socket.IPPROTO_IPV6, socket.IPV6_V6ONLY, False)
except OSError as e:
logger.error(f"Warning: Could not set IPV6_V6ONLY to False. System may not support dual-stack or option is unavailable. Error: {e}")
# 3. Bind to all interfaces (::) on a specific port
# UDP server endpoint (handler wired to handle_datagram with context) # UDP server endpoint (handler wired to handle_datagram with context)
bind_addr = ("0.0.0.0", config.get("hb_port", 50003)) bind_addr = ("::", config.get("hb_port", 50003))
sock.bind(bind_addr)
